Advanced Leak Detection Technologies Used by AnyLeak
Our team at AnyLeak utilizes industry-leading leak detection technology to provide non-invasive, highly accurate leak detection solutions for property managers and developers in Metro Vancouver.
Thermal Imaging
Using infrared cameras, we detect temperature variations in walls, ceilings, and floors to identify hidden moisture and leaks without cutting into surfaces.
Acoustic Leak Detection
Our specialized listening devices detect the sounds of water escaping from pipes, allowing us to locate leaks deep within plumbing systems, even under concrete slabs.
Moisture Meters & Hygrometers
These tools measure moisture levels in building materials, helping us identify areas affected by leaks or water damage.
Hydrostatic Pressure Testing
We conduct pressure tests on plumbing systems to identify slow leaks in water lines, drain systems, and underground pipes.
Tracer Gas Detection
For complex leaks that are hard to find, we use safe, non-toxic tracer gas to pinpoint even the smallest pipe leaks.

Common Leak Issues in Rental & Strata Properties
- Pipe Leaks in Walls & Ceilings – Aging plumbing systems or construction defects can lead to hidden pipe leaks.
- Roof & Balcony Leaks – Poor sealing, flashing failures, and weather exposure can cause water intrusion.
- Foundation & Slab Leaks – Underground leaks can weaken foundations and lead to costly structural damage.
- Bathroom & Kitchen Leaks – Slow leaks in fixtures, sinks, and appliances contribute to water waste and mold growth.
- HVAC & Boiler Leaks – Faulty heating and cooling systems can result in water damage and high repair costs.

Leak Risks in New Construction Projects
- Plumbing Installation Errors – Faulty pipe connections and pressure irregularities can lead to hidden leaks.
- Envelope & Window Seal Failures – Poor waterproofing in new builds allows moisture infiltration.
- Underground Piping Issues – Improper drainage or leaks in underground utility lines can go unnoticed until significant damage occurs.
- Flat Roof & Waterproofing Defects – Improperly installed roofing membranes can cause leaks in commercial and multi-unit developments.
